The Golden State Warriors have reportedly added guard Dalen Terry to their roster on an Exhibit 10 contract. This move follows recent signings of Brandon Williams and Georges Niang, as the team finalizes its lineup for the upcoming season. Terry, a 24-year-old guard, was originally selected by the Chicago Bulls in the 2022 NBA draft.
Terry spent four seasons with the Bulls before playing 14 games for the Philadelphia 76ers last season. To remain with the Warriors, Terry must earn a spot on the 15-player roster, as he is ineligible for a two-way contract. Should he be waived before the season begins, he may join the Santa Cruz Warriors. Golden State's training camp is scheduled to open on September 29 in San Francisco.
